Why Move to Haarlemmermeer?

Haarlemmermeer is a unique municipality located in the heart of the Randstad. It is not just one city but a collection of towns and villages, with Hoofddorp and Nieuw-Vennep being the largest. As the home of Schiphol Airport, it is one of the most internationally connected places in Europe.

The area is a powerhouse of economic activity, hosting hundreds of international corporate headquarters. For expats, this means excellent job opportunities, particularly in logistics, tech, and aviation. Despite its business focus, the municipality offers a high quality of residential life with modern housing and green spaces.

Living in Haarlemmermeer offers the perfect balance between urban accessibility and suburban comfort. You are just minutes away from Amsterdam, Haarlem, and Leiden, but you can enjoy more space for your money than in the larger neighboring cities. It is an ideal choice for professionals working at Schiphol or in the Zuidas business district.

Cost of Living

Haarlemmermeer is a premium location due to its proximity to Schiphol and Amsterdam. While slightly more affordable than the capital, prices remain high. Here is what to budget in 2026:

Rental Prices

Property Type Monthly Rent
Studio / 1-room €950 - €1,300
1-bedroom apartment €1,250 - €1,750
2-bedroom apartment €1,600 - €2,100
Family house (3+ bed) €2,200 - €3,500+

Buying Prices

Property Type Price Range
Apartment (1-2 bed) €350,000 - €550,000
Family house €500,000 - €900,000+

Monthly Expenses (Single Person)

Expense Amount / month
Groceries €300 - €450
Health insurance €140 - €180
Public transport (R-net) €70 - €130
Utilities (gas, electric, water) €170 - €260
Internet + mobile €50 - €80
Gym membership €35 - €70

Source: CBS, Funda, Pararius (2025-2026 data). Prices vary by village and proximity to train stations.


Best Neighborhoods

Haarlemmermeer offers a variety of living environments, from bustling town centers to quiet polder villages:

Hoofddorp-Centrum

Urban, convenient, busy

The urban heart of the municipality. Offers a wide range of shops, restaurants, and a major cinema. Ideal for young professionals who want to be close to the train station for quick commutes to Amsterdam or Schiphol.

Typical rent: €1,300 – €1,850

Floriande (Hoofddorp)

Family-oriented, green, modern

A large, modern residential district on the edge of Hoofddorp. Extremely popular with families due to its many schools, playgrounds, and the Haarlemmermeerse Bos nearby. It has its own shopping center and health facilities.

Typical rent: €1,500 – €2,200

Nieuw-Vennep

Quiet, community, spacious

The second largest town in the municipality. It has a more relaxed, community-focused feel than Hoofddorp. It offers excellent value for money and has its own train station connecting directly to Leiden and Schiphol.

Typical rent: €1,200 – €1,700

Badhoevedorp

Village-like, suburban, upscale

Located very close to the Amsterdam border. It feels more like a village but benefits from immediate access to the city. Highly sought after by those working in Amsterdam who want a more suburban lifestyle.

Typical rent: €1,400 – €2,000

Registration & BSN

When moving to Haarlemmermeer, you must register at the Gemeentehuis (City Hall) located in Hoofddorp. You should do this within 5 days of your arrival. This process provides you with your BSN (Burgerservicenummer), which is essential for almost every aspect of Dutch life.

Step-by-Step

  1. 1 Make an appointment online at haarlemmermeer.nl.
  2. 2 Bring your valid ID (passport or ID card).
  3. 3 Bring your rental or purchase agreement.
  4. 4 If applicable, bring your legalized birth certificate and marriage certificate.
  5. 5 You will receive your BSN shortly after the appointment.

If you are a 'Highly Skilled Migrant' working for a recognized sponsor, you may be able to handle your registration through the Expat Center (IN Amsterdam) located in the World Trade Center Amsterdam, which covers the Haarlemmermeer region.


Getting Around

Haarlemmermeer is arguably the best-connected region in the Netherlands. It serves as a major node for rail and bus networks.

Trains from Hoofddorp station reach Schiphol in 4 minutes and Amsterdam Zuid in 10 minutes.
The R-net bus network provides high-frequency, reliable connections throughout the municipality and to neighboring cities.
Cycling is very popular and the municipality has invested heavily in fast cycle paths (snelfietspaden).
Direct train access from Nieuw-Vennep to Leiden and The Hague.
Immediate access to major highways (A4, A5, A9, A10) for car travel.

The Zuidtangent is a dedicated bus lane that allows buses to bypass traffic, making travel between Haarlem, Hoofddorp, Schiphol, and Amsterdam Zuidoost extremely fast. Public transport is often faster than driving during peak hours.


Expat Community & Schools

Because of the high concentration of international companies, Haarlemmermeer is home to a very diverse expat population. Integration is relatively easy as many people are in a similar situation.

Education options for international families include:

  • Optimist International School (Hoofddorp): A primary school offering the International Primary Curriculum (IPC).
  • Nearby options in Amsterdam and Amstelveen for international secondary education.
  • Excellent Dutch public schools that provide 'taalklassen' (language classes) for non-Dutch speaking children.

The municipality offers many sports clubs, gyms, and community centers. The Haarlemmermeerse Bos is a popular spot for outdoor activities and hosting major festivals like Mysteryland.


Healthcare

The main hospital for the region is the Spaarne Gasthuis, which has a large, modern facility in Hoofddorp. It provides comprehensive emergency and specialist care.

You are required to have Dutch health insurance. Once registered, find a local GP (huisarts) in your specific town or village. Most GPs speak fluent English and are used to working with international patients.

For urgent medical care outside of office hours, you should contact the 'Huisartsenpost' at the Spaarne Gasthuis. Always call first unless it is a life-threatening emergency (call 112).


Frequently Asked Questions

Is it noisy living near Schiphol Airport?

Noise levels vary significantly depending on which village or neighborhood you choose. Modern housing in areas like Floriande is well-insulated. Many residents find they quickly get used to the aircraft noise, but it's important to check the specific noise contours of a property before renting or buying.

How long is the commute to Amsterdam?

From Hoofddorp station, it is just 10-15 minutes to Amsterdam Zuid or Amsterdam Lelylaan. From Nieuw-Vennep, it takes about 20-25 minutes.

Are there many international people in Haarlemmermeer?

Yes, especially in Hoofddorp and Badhoevedorp. The proximity to Schiphol and major business parks attracts thousands of internationals from all over the world.

What is there to do for recreation?

The Haarlemmermeerse Bos offers swimming, walking, and events. There are also extensive shopping facilities in Hoofddorp-Centrum and excellent sports facilities throughout the municipality.

Is Haarlemmermeer cheaper than Amsterdam?

Generally, yes. You will typically get more square meters for your money, and modern family houses are more available. However, because it is a prime business location, it is still more expensive than cities further from the Randstad.
